CA Barbri, but have started already using other help for the MBE - Barbri's not bad, but just better for essays and I don't want to waste time making my own flashcards. A friend of mine got cards from Critical Pass (http://www.criticalpass.com) for only $50. They're really good, especially for that price, so I ordered a set and I know others at my school have too. Pretty helpful. Other than that, just sticking with the Barbri schedule.
